Borrell in Washington says fresh aid for Ukraine can't wait

Josep Borrell, EU High Representative for Foreign Affairs and Security Policy, has said after meetings in Washington on 14 March that further support for Ukraine must not be delayed, given the likelihood of another Russian offensive.

Details: The EU's top diplomat told journalists he had conveyed a simple message to US politicians: "Whatever has to be done, it has to be done quickly."

"It's true for us. We have to speed up. We have to increase our support, to do more and quicker. That's why we are increasing our industrial defence capacities. And it is also true for the US," Borrell said.

He added that "the next few months will be decisive" for the full-scale Russian invasion of Ukraine.

"Many analysts expect a major Russian offensive this summer, and Ukraine cannot wait until the result of the next US elections," the top EU diplomat said.

Mike Johnson, Speaker of the US House of Representatives, has refused to schedule a vote on a bill that would provide Ukraine with an additional US$60 billion in aid.

He has promised to prepare his own draft to support Ukraine, which may offer support in the form of a loan or lend-lease to protect American taxpayers' interests. The White House has rejected this idea.
